'' is a 2023 Indian action thriller film written and directed by Vamsee and produced by Abhishek Agarwal under the banner Abhishek Agarwal Arts. The film was a pan-Indian project, released in Telugu, Hindi, Tamil, Kannada, and Malayalam. At its heart was the story of a notorious dacoit from the Stuartpuram region in Andhra Pradesh, a man who, according to local lore and 'true rumours' (as the film's opening note states), functioned like a Robin Hood-like figure for his village. The film received a mixed critical reception, with some praising Ravi Teja's performance and the film's visual scale, while others criticized its lengthy runtime of over three hours and subpar visual effects in certain scenes. The Times of India gave the film a rating of 3.0/5, stating that it "manages to impress, largely due to Ravi Teja's stellar performance". The Hindu, in its review, noted that the film "begins with promise and withers into an overdrawn, generic tale".
